Serial Remote RS-232C Port (DB-9, female)
Connects the RS-232C control connector on external equipment to the monitor. The
monitor can be operated according to control commands sent from external equip-
ment connected to it. For details of the pin assignment and factory setting function,
see Appendix D.
1.3.4
YPrPb/RGBS Port (BNC)
PDC-190S supports component signal for RGB/YPrPb color difference. From left to
right they are R/Pr, B/Pb, G/Y and external sync signal for RGB signal.
1.3.5
CVBS In/Out Port (BNC)
PDC-190S supports a composite video port. PDC-190S also supports Loop-through
output of the composite signal input to the input connectors.
1.3.6
Y/C In/Out Port (4-pin mini-DIN)
PDC-190S supports a Y/C signal port. PDC-190S also supports Loop-through output
of the Y/C signal input to the input connectors.
1.3.7
SDI In/Out Port (BNC)
PDC-190S supports an SDI signal port. PDC-190S also supports Loop-through out-
put of the SDI signal input to the input connectors. The terminals accept the following
signals.
!
SMPTE292M HD SDI signal
!
SMPTE259M SD SDI signal
The signal is output from the Loop-through terminal only when the monitor is ON.
1.3.8
Audio Port (Audio Jack)
PDC-190S supports one audio line-in port, and the audio volume can be adjusted via
OSD.
1.3.9
USB Type B Port and USB Type A Port
There is one USB 2.0 input that can accept signals from an external standard PC via
the type B connector of PDC-190S. The PDC-190S provides two USB 2.0 hub func-
tions via a type A connector.
